    "Brighton, NY – eBaumsworld.com sponsors Hasim “The Rock” Rahman for upcoming Don King HBO Pay-Per-View event in Madison Square Garden.
    This week, eBaumsworld.com, the fastest growing humor and entertainment website, announced they will be sponsoring former heavyweight boxing champion, Hasim “The Rock” Rahman in his fight against Kali Meehan, the WBA/IBF Asia Pacific Champion from Australia. The bout will take place in Madison Square Garden on Saturday, November 13th and is one of four heavyweight bouts scheduled for the night. The event is sponsored by Don King Productions and will be shown on HBO Pay-Per-View.

    “I’m a huge boxing fan, and Hasim is not only a great boxer, he’s a great person as well,” said Eric Bauman, age 25 and owner/operator of eBaumsworld.com, “He can help restore the positive image and dignity that boxing held in its heyday, unlike the ear-biting antics and never-ending ranking disputes of recent times.” Bauman and Rahman first met at the “Fight Night at Frontier” in Rochester, NY back in July and have worked closely together since.
